WebApr 30, 2024 · Ottawa, April 5, 2024 – On April 30, 2024,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) is increasing fees for all permanent residence applications. This includes economic, permit holder, family and humanitarian classes. In 2024, IRCC increased permanent residence fees to account for inflation for the first time since 2002. Web2 days ago · Ahmed Emam and his wife, Bassant, have been planning a summer wedding celebration in Egypt, but a delayed permanent residency application could force the … WebApr 30, 2024 · The LINC program is funded by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C). You do not have to pay to for LINC classes. LINC provides basic language skills. If you need specific language skills, you may want to consider a program that better fits your educational or career goals.
